#de6462 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#de6462 is composed of 87.1% red, 39.2%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55% magenta, 55.9%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 1 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 62.7%. #de6462 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8c4 with #bd0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

● #de6462 color description : Soft red.
The hexadecimal color #de6462 has RGB values of R:222, G:100,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.56,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14574690.
